Untitled Unmastered (stylized as untitled unmastered.) is a compilation album by American rapper Kendrick Lamar.It was released on March 4, 2016, by Top Dawg Entertainment, Aftermath Entertainment and Interscope Records.It consists of previously unreleased demos that originated during the recording of Lamar's album To Pimp a Butterfly (2015), continuing that work's exploration of politically.
